In spite of being cheap, they require more space and produce less electricity than monocrystalline or polycrystalline panels. In general, thin film solar panels are not used widely for residential solar installations because of their low panel efficiency. The most popularly used photovoltaic material in this solar panel is Cadmium Telluride (CdTe). They are usually lightweight and flexible and are made using photovoltaic substances instead of Silicon crystals. The third one is the thin film types of solar panels in India. Their construction allows them to be on a slightly cheaper side than Mono SI, in terms of cost. The panel efficiency is usually around 15-17%, but certain new technologies have enabled these types of solar panels for houses to push their efficiencies in the range of Mono SI. These panels generally tend to have a blue color due to the presence of the multiple crystals in these wafers. While this is also made out of pure silicon crystals, the difference between poly SI and mono SI is that the type of solar cells and their efficiency in this solar panel consists of polycrystalline solar cells that are composed of fragments of silicon crystals, melted together in a mould before being cut into wafers. However, due to the high performance of these panels, you would need lesser number of Mono SI panels than polycrystalline panels in your solar system, for the same power output. Given their high efficiency and power, their cost also tends to be on the higher side in comparison to polycrystalline panels. If you see a black solar panel with square shaped silicon wafers having their corners cut off, it is a monocrystalline panel. The black color is due to how light interacts with the pure silicon crystal. Each of the individual solar cells contain a silicon wafer that is made of a single and pure crystal of silicon, and hence the name monocrystalline. these panels have a high aesthetic value, thereby tending to make it a popular option among types of solar panel installations in India.
